datasheetbank_Logo
Integrated circuits, Transistor, Semiconductors Search and Datasheet PDF Download Site

DP805X View Datasheet(PDF) - Digital Core Design

Part Name
Description
View to exact match
DP805X Datasheet PDF : 79 Pages
1 2 3 4 5 6 7 8 9 10 Next Last
DP805x Instructions set details
2.2.2. LOGIC OPERATIONS
-8-
Mnemonic
ANL A,Rn
ANL A,direct
ANL A,@Ri
ANL A,#data
ANL direct,A
ANL direct,#data
ORL A,Rn
ORL A,direct
ORL A,@Ri
ORL A,#data
ORL direct,A
ORL direct,#data
XRL A,Rn
XRL A,direct
XRL A,@Ri
XRL A,#data
XRL direct,A
XRL direct,#data
CLR A
CPL A
RL A
RLC A
RR A
RRC A
SWAP A
Description
AND register to accumulator
AND direct byte to accumulator
AND indirect RAM to accumulator
AND immediate data to accumulator
AND accumulator to direct byte
AND immediate data to direct byte
OR register to accumulator
OR direct byte to accumulator
OR indirect RAM to accumulator
OR immediate data to accumulator
OR accumulator to direct byte
OR immediate data to direct byte
Exclusive OR register to accumulator
Exclusive OR direct byte to accumulator
Exclusive OR indirect RAM to accumulator
Exclusive OR immediate data to accumulator
Exclusive OR accumulator to direct byte
Exclusive OR immediate data to direct byte
Clear accumulator
Complement accumulator
Rotate accumulator left
Rotate accumulator left through carry
Rotate accumulator right
Rotate accumulator right through carry
Swap nibbles within the accumulator
Table 4. Logic operations
Code
0x58-0x5F
0x55
0x56-0x57
0x54
0x52
0x53
0x48-0x4F
0x45
0x46-0x47
0x44
0x42
0x43
0x68-0x6F
0x65
0x66-0x67
0x64
0x62
0x63
0xE4
0xF4
0x23
0x33
0x03
0x13
0xC4
Bytes Cycles
1
1
2
2
1
2
2
2
2
3
3
3
1
1
2
2
1
2
2
2
2
3
3
3
1
1
2
2
1
2
2
2
2
3
3
3
1
1
1
1
1
1
1
1
1
1
1
1
1
1
2.2.3. BOOLEAN MANIPULATION
Mnemonic
CLR C
CLR bit
SETB C
SETB bit
CPL C
CPL bit
ANL C,bit
ANL C,/bit
ORL C,bit
ORL C,/bit
MOV C,bit
MOV bit,C
Description
Clear carry flag
Clear direct bit
Set carry flag
Set direct bit
Complement carry flag
Complement direct bit
AND direct bit to carry flag
AND complement of direct bit to carry
OR direct bit to carry flag
OR complement of direct bit to carry
Move direct bit to carry flag
Move carry flag to direct bit
Table 5. Boolean manipulation
Code
0xC3
0xC2
0xD3
0xD2
0xB3
0xB2
0x82
0xB0
0x72
0xA0
0xA2
0x92
Bytes Cycles
1
1
2
3
1
1
2
3
1
1
2
3
2
2
2
2
2
2
2
2
2
2
2
3
All trademarks mentioned in this document
are trademarks of their respective owners.
http://www.DigitalCoreDesign.com
http://www.dcd.pl
Copyright 1999-2003 DCD – Digital Core Design. All Rights Reserved.
 

Share Link: 

datasheetbank.com [ Privacy Policy ] [ Request Datasheet ] [ Contact Us ]